How much do computer software jobs pay per year?

As of Jun 25, 2026, the average yearly pay for computer software in Utah is $101,821.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$81,900.00 and $118,300.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is the difference between Computer Software vs Software Developer?

AspectComputer SoftwareSoftware Developer
CredentialsTypically requires a degree in computer science or related fieldRequires a degree in computer science, software engineering, or related field; coding certifications are common
Work EnvironmentDeveloped and maintained across various industries, often in office or remote settingsPrimarily works in office or remote environments, focusing on coding, testing, and debugging
Industry UsageRefers to the actual programs and applications used by end-users or businessesRefers to the role of creating, designing, and maintaining software applications

Computer Software encompasses the actual programs and applications used in various industries, while Software Developers are professionals who create and maintain these programs. The roles overlap significantly, but the software refers to the product, and the developer is the person building it.

What are computer software jobs?

Computer software jobs refer to careers focused on designing, developing, testing, and maintaining software applications or systems. These roles can include software engineers, developers, testers, quality assurance analysts, and system architects. Professionals in this field work with programming languages and software tools to create solutions for computers, mobile devices, or web platforms. Computer software jobs exist across various industries, including technology, finance, healthcare, and entertainment. These roles often require strong problem-solving skills, attention to detail, and knowledge of coding languages.

Which software job is the highest paid?

Software engineering roles such as software architects, machine learning engineers, and solutions architects tend to be among the highest paid in the industry. These positions often require advanced skills in programming, system design, and experience with cloud platforms, and they typically offer higher salaries compared to other software-related roles.

What are some common challenges faced by professionals working in computer software development teams?

One common challenge in computer software development is effectively collaborating across multidisciplinary teams, especially when team members have varying technical backgrounds or are distributed across different locations. Managing project timelines and adapting to rapidly changing requirements can also be demanding, requiring strong communication and agile problem-solving skills. Additionally, keeping up with fast-evolving technologies and best practices is essential for continued success and can be a source of both challenge and opportunity for professional growth.

Is it true that AI will replace software engineers?

AI is transforming software engineering by automating certain tasks like code generation and testing, but it is unlikely to fully replace software engineers. Instead, AI tools serve as complements that enhance productivity, requiring engineers to focus on complex problem-solving, system design, and oversight. Continuous learning and adapting to new technologies remain essential for software engineers in an evolving AI-driven environment.
